What Is Mold on Carpet and Why Is It Problematic?
Mold on carpet is defined as a type of fungus that grows in damp, warm, and poorly ventilated areas, often manifesting as dark spots or patches on carpet fibers. This growth occurs when moisture infiltrates the carpet material, creating an ideal environment for mold spores to thrive. Common types of mold found on carpets include Aspergillus and Stachybotrys, the latter also known as black mold, which can pose significant health risks.
According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), mold can cause a range of health issues, particularly for individuals with respiratory conditions, allergies, or weakened immune systems. The presence of mold on carpets not only affects indoor air quality but also can lead to structural damage in homes if left untreated. The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) emphasizes the importance of addressing moisture problems to prevent mold growth, highlighting that carpets can easily absorb water and humidity, facilitating mold proliferation.
Key aspects of mold on carpet include its growth conditions, types, and potential health risks. Mold typically thrives in environments with a relative humidity above 60%, and the materials used in carpets, such as wool or synthetic fibers, can retain moisture. The growth cycle of m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ours of water exposure, making immediate remediation crucial. Additionally, the spores released into the air can lead to respiratory issues, skin irritation, and other allergic reactions, which can significantly impact the well-being of occupants in a home.
This issue impacts not only health but also property values and maintenance costs. Homes with mold issues may face decreased marketability, as potential buyers often shy away from properties with known mold problems. Furthermore, the cost of remediation can escalate quickly, with estimates ranging from a few hundred dollars for minor cases to thousands for extensive mold infestations, especially if professional intervention is required.
The benefits of addressing mold on carpets include improved indoor air quality, enhanced health and safety for occupants, and preservation of property value. Regular maintenance, such as vacuuming with HEPA filters, ensuring proper ventilation, and controlling indoor humidity levels, can significantly reduce the likelihood of mold growth. Additionally, the best products for mold removal on carpets often include specialized cleaners that target mold spores, such as those containing enzymes or antimicrobial agents, which can effectively eliminate mold without damaging the carpet fibers.
Solutions and best practices for preventing mold on carpet include promptly addressing any water leaks or spills, using dehumidifiers in high-humidity areas, and ensuring that carpets are cleaned and dried thoroughly after any exposure to moisture. In cases where mold is already present, professional mold remediation services may be necessary to safely remove mold and restore the affected area.
What Causes Mold Growth on Carpet?
Mold growth on carpet can be caused by several environmental factors and conditions that favor its proliferation.
- Excess Moisture: Mold thrives in damp environments, so any water intrusion from spills, leaks, or high humidity can create the perfect conditions for it to grow.
- Poor Ventilation: Areas with limited airflow can trap moisture and create a stagnant environment that promotes mold development.
- Organic Material: Carpets made from natural fibers like wool or cotton can provide a food source for mold spores, facilitating their growth.
- Temperature: Warm temperatures can accelerate mold growth, especially when combined with moisture, making it more likely to proliferate on carpets in warmer climates.
- Lack of Regular Cleaning: Accumulated dirt and debris can retain moisture and provide nutrients for mold, so infrequent cleaning can increase the risk of mold on carpets.
Excess moisture is one of the primary contributors to mold growth, as mold spores require water to germinate and thrive. This moisture can come from various sources, including spills, leaks from pipes, or even high humidity levels in the environment.
Poor ventilation exacerbates the mold problem by creating a microclimate where moisture remains trapped. Without adequate airflow, the dampness persists, allowing mold spores to settle and grow.
Organic materials found in carpets, especially those made from natural fibers, can serve as food for mold. This is particularly true for carpets that have not been treated with mold-resistant substances.
The temperature of the environment plays a significant role in mold growth as well. Warmer temperatures generally promote faster growth rates, especially in conjunction with moisture.
Finally, a lack of regular cleaning can lead to the buildup of dust, dirt, and organic matter, which can retain moisture and serve as a breeding ground for mold. Frequent vacuuming and cleaning can help mitigate the conditions that lead to mold proliferation.
How Can I Identify Mold on My Carpet?
Identifying mold on your carpet can be crucial for maintaining a healthy living environment, and there are several signs and methods to help you do so.
- Visual Inspection: Look for dark spots or discoloration on the carpet that may indicate mold growth.
- Smell Test: A musty odor in the room can be a strong indicator of mold presence.
- Moisture Detection: Check for damp areas or water damage, as mold thrives in moist conditions.
- Use of Mold Test Kits: Consider using commercially available mold test kits that can help identify mold spores in the carpet.
- Professional Inspection: Hiring a professional can provide a thorough assessment and help confirm the presence of mold.
Visual Inspection: Start by closely examining the carpet for any unusual spots, particularly areas that are darker or have a fuzzy texture. Mold often appears as black, green, or white patches, and it can be easily mistaken for dirt or stains if not carefully scrutinized.
Smell Test: Pay attention to any lingering musty odors, especially in areas that are not frequently visited or ventilated. This smell is often caused by mold spores and can help you locate hidden mold growth beneath or within the carpet fibers.
Moisture Detection: Check for any signs of moisture, such as a wet carpet or previously water-damaged areas. Mold typically grows in damp environments, so if you find any moisture issues, it’s essential to investigate further for mold presence.
Use of Mold Test Kits: Mold test kits are available at many home improvement stores and can help you identify mold spores in your carpet. These kits often include petri dishes or swabs that you can use to collect samples, which can then be sent to a lab for analysis.
Professional Inspection: If you suspect significant mold issues, it may be wise to hire a professional mold inspector. These experts have specialized equipment and training to detect mold and assess the extent of the problem, ensuring a thorough evaluation of your carpet and surrounding areas.
What Are the Best Products for Removing Mold from Carpet?
The best products for removing mold from carpet include:
- White Vinegar: A natural and effective solution, white vinegar can kill most species of mold and is safe for use on carpets.
- Baking Soda: This versatile product not only removes odors but also helps to eliminate mold when mixed with water and applied to affected areas.
- Hydrogen Peroxide: A powerful disinfectant, hydrogen peroxide can penetrate the carpet fibers and kill mold spores without leaving harmful residues.
- Commercial Mold Removers: These specialized products are formulated to target mold effectively, often containing antifungal agents for enhanced results.
- Steam Cleaners: Using high-temperature steam, these machines can kill mold spores and sanitize carpets, providing a deep clean.
White vinegar is a popular choice for many homeowners due to its non-toxic nature and effectiveness in killing mold spores. When applied directly to the carpet, it can help to neutralize odors and prevent further growth.
Baking soda is not only an effective mold remover but also an excellent deodorizer. By mixing it with water to create a paste, you can apply it to the moldy area, allowing it to sit and absorb moisture before vacuuming it up.
Hydrogen peroxide is known for its ability to break down mold on a molecular level. When used at a concentration of around 3%, it can be sprayed onto affected areas, making it easy to spot-treat carpets without damaging the fibers.
Commercial mold removers often contain specific ingredients designed to eliminate mold while also preventing future growth. They are typically easy to use, requiring only application and a short wait time before blotting or rinsing.
Steam cleaners are an excellent investment for those looking to maintain a mold-free environment. The high heat not only kills mold spores but also sanitizes the carpet, making it an effective method for both cleaning and prevention.

How Do I Use the Recommended Products to Remove Mold from Carpet?
To effectively remove mold from carpet, you can utilize a variety of products specifically designed for this purpose.
- Vinegar: White vinegar is a natural antifungal agent that can help eliminate mold spores from carpets.
- Hydrogen Peroxide: This powerful oxidizing agent not only kills mold but also helps to whiten the carpet without damaging it.
- Baking Soda: Known for its deodorizing properties, baking soda can absorb moisture and inhibit mold growth when sprinkled on carpets.
- Commercial Mold Removers: These specialized products are formulated to target mold effectively, often containing antifungal ingredients that help prevent regrowth.
- Steam Cleaners: Using steam cleaning equipment can penetrate carpet fibers, effectively killing mold spores with high temperatures and moisture.
Vinegar can be applied directly to the affected area; its acidity helps break down mold while leaving a fresh scent. Simply spray the vinegar onto the moldy spot, let it sit for an hour, then blot with a clean cloth.
Hydrogen peroxide can be applied in a similar manner; it is effective on a variety of surfaces and can also help with stain removal. Use a 3% solution, spray it onto the carpet, allow it to sit for at least 10 minutes, and then blot with a cloth.
Baking soda can be used as a preventive measure as well as a cleaning agent. After sprinkling it on the affected area, let it sit overnight to absorb moisture and odors, then vacuum it up to see significant improvement.
Commercial mold removers often come with specific instructions for use, so it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for the best results. These products can vary in strength and application method, so choosing one suitable for carpets is crucial.
Steam cleaners are highly effective for deep cleaning carpets, as they use heat and moisture to eliminate mold without the need for harsh chemicals. Make s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for your specific steam cleaner model to achieve optimal results.
